SQW is looking for Senior Consultants to join our team to help deliver high-impact research, strategy and evaluation projects across the UK.

SQW is a leading independent consultancy in economic and social development. We provide research, analysis and insight to support public policy, working with a wide range of clients including central government, local authorities, universities and the private sector. Our 50 consultants are based at our offices in London, Edinburgh and Manchester, with a hybrid working approach in place.

Role Overview

As a Senior Consultant, you’ll provide research and advice work on projects on that span:

  • Local/sub-national economic development – local economic development (with an increasing focus on sustainability/net zero and inclusivity alongside local economic competitiveness and regeneration). Projects range in scale from site level (including major new developments) through to sub-regions, city-regions and broader areas.
  • Innovation, enterprise and business growth – enterprise and business support, financial instruments to support firms, and the role of science and innovation in developing places, clusters and sectors.

Across these fields, our work includes the preparation of evidence-based strategies and action plans; appraisals and business cases; economic impact assessments; and policy and programme evaluations.

You’ll lead and contribute to:

  • Socio-economic qualitative and quantitative research and analysis
  • HM Treasury Green Book-compliant business cases
  • Economic impact assessments and evaluations
  • Strategy development and action planning

You’ll also manage projects, mentor junior colleagues, and help shape new proposals with creative, evidence-based approaches.

SQW is committed to making a positive impact on our clients and society, delivering social value through our work. We maintain an active social value policy, and implement a programme of activities (including providing increasing opportunities for staff volunteering and fundraising, facilitated by an employee-led Charity Committee). We are committed to being a net zero company by 2030, which means that we will reduce our emissions as far as is practical and offset the remaining emissions.
